What Happened: Shopify's Blowout Quarter

Shopify (SHOP) reported second-quarter results that blew past analyst expectations, sending shares up nearly 17% to close at $144.24. The company delivered strong growth across all key metrics: GMV, revenue, gross profits, and free cash flow all grew by more than 30% year-over-year. Management also raised guidance for the third quarter, projecting sales growth in the low-thirties percentage range.

Trading volume was exceptionally heavy, with 40.5 million shares changing hands, about 263% above the three-month average. This surge in activity reflects heightened investor interest and conviction in Shopify's story.

President Harley Finkelstein highlighted that AI-driven traffic and orders to Shopify stores tripled year-over-year in Q2. The company's AI-powered assistant, Sidekick, saw daily active merchants nearly quadruple from last year, and merchants used it to create 36,000 custom apps, up from 12,000 just one quarter ago.

The broader market was mixed, with the S&P 500 down 0.19% and the Nasdaq down 0.83%. Among peers, Etsy fell 0.71%, while eBay rose 1.40%.

Why It Matters: AI and Growth Trajectory

Shopify's strong quarter demonstrates that AI is becoming a tailwind rather than a threat. The company's ability to integrate AI into its platform is attracting merchants and driving engagement, which could lead to sustained growth and improved monetization.

The raised Q3 guidance suggests management's confidence in continued momentum. If Shopify can maintain 30%+ growth, it could justify its premium valuation over time, especially as it expands its AI capabilities.

However, the stock trades at 89 times free cash flow and 78 times next year's earnings, making it expensive by traditional metrics. Any slowdown in growth or macroeconomic headwinds could lead to significant multiple compression.

For investors, this news reinforces Shopify's position as a leader in e-commerce software, but it also raises the bar for future performance. The company must continue to execute flawlessly to justify its valuation.
